Geographic Location of Arajpuri


The village Arajpuri is located in Dondi Luhara Tahsil of Balod District in the State of Chhattisgarh in India. It is governed by Arajpuri Gram Panchayat. It comes under Dondiluhara Community Development Block. The nearest town is Daundi Lohara, which is about 17 kilometers away from Arajpuri.

Travel and Communication for Arajpuri


Private buses services are available for the village. There is a railway station more than 10 kms away from the village.

Social Structure of Arajpuri


As per available data from the year 2009, 1810 persons live in 398 house holds in the village Arajpuri. There are 961 female individuals and 849 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 53.09% and males constitute 46.91% of the total population.

There are 168 scheduled castes persons of which 94 are females and 74 are males. Females constitute 55.95% and males constitute 44.05%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 9.28% of the total population.

There are 1193 scheduled tribes persons of which 632 are females and 561 are males. Females constitute 52.98% and males constitute 47.02%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 65.91% of the total population.

Population density of Arajpuri is 174.35 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Arajpuri

Total area of Arajpuri is 1038.15 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 467.24 ha. About 467.24 ha is un-irrigated area.

About 150.44 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 64.17 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ands.

About 15.6 ha is lying as current fallow area. About 82.66 ha is culturable waste land. About 76.8 ha is lying as fallow land other than current fallows. About 0.6 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.

Schools in Arajpuri


There are no private or government pre-primary schools in the village. However, there is a government pre-primary school in Rengadabri, which is 5-10 kms away from Arajpuri.

There is a government primary school in the village Arajpuri.

There is a government middle school in the village Arajpuri.

There is a government secondary school in the village Arajpuri.

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private senior secondary school in Bhanwar Mara, which is less than 5 kms away from Arajpuri.

Healthcare Facilities in Arajpuri


There is a community health centre more than 10 kms away from Arajpuri.

There is a primary health centre with 2 doctors and 1 paramedical staff in the village Arajpuri.

There is a primary health sub-centre less than 5 kms away from Arajpuri.

There is a maternity and child welfare centre with 1 doctors and 1 paramedical staff in the village Arajpuri.

There is a TB clinic more than 10 kms away from Arajpuri.

There is no allopathic hospital in the village Arajpuri or anywhere in the nearby villages.

There is a alternative medicine hospital with 2 doctors and 2 paramedical staff in the village Arajpuri.

There is a dispensary less than 5 kms away from Arajpuri.

There is a veterinary hospital less than 5 kms away from Arajpuri.

There is a mobile health centre more than 10 kms away from Arajpuri.

There is a family welfare centre more than 10 kms away from Arajpuri.

*Note: Most of the above information provided as per data compiled from the year 2009.
